OBJECTIVE
To investigate the wound-healing potency of the ethanolic extract of the flowers of Hibiscus rosa sinensis.
METHODS
The wound-healing activity of H. rosa sinensis (5 and 10% w/w) on Wistar albino rats was studied using three different models viz., excision, incision and dead space wound.

BACKGROUND
The leaves of Hibiscus rosa-sinensis L. (Malvaceae) are used for the treatment of dysentery and diarrhea, to promote draining of abscesses and as analgesic agent in the traditional medicine of Cook Islands, Haiti, Japan and Mexico.
